The Heinkel He.111, a German bomber from WWII's Luftwaffe, serves as a historical replica of coded A1+DA aircraft, belonging to the KG 53 unit group stationed in France during August 1940. This plane participated in bombing British towns during the Battle of Britain. The 3D model is low-poly and suitable for gaming purposes with PBR rendering-ready materials. Created using Blender 2.79, it features 10 objects and 6889 polygons, subdivision readiness, and utilizes Cycles render engine. Textures include 2 materials in sizes of 4096px and 1024px (Diffuse, Metallic, Roughness, Normal, Height, AO, and Opacity) in PNG format. Notably, the model boasts real scale, organized scene objects via armature skeletons and groups, but file formats exclude textures which are stored in a designated 'Textures' folder. Additionally, the rigged, animated model features propeller animations and wheel positions for inside or outside wing configurations; however, the HDRI is not included.
